The Shytoshi Kusama-Litecoin Rumor: A Macro Watcher's Take on Narrative and Noise

CryptoRover
Watching the silence between the candlesticks, I notice something peculiar. The market is euphoric, Bitcoin is flirting with new highs, and yet the loudest noise in the SHIB community is not about Shibarium's TVL or the latest burn mechanism. It's a whisper: Shytoshi Kusama, the enigmatic lead of the Shiba Inu ecosystem, might have a connection to Litecoin. A SHIB veteran has given a take, and the speculation is spreading. But as a macro watcher who has spent years harvesting the liquidity that others overlook, I can't help but ask: what does this rumor actually reveal about the state of crypto in a bull market? Let me provide context. Shytoshi Kusama is the pseudonymous 'chief ambassador' of Shiba Inu, the meme coin that rode the 2021 wave to become a multi-billion dollar ecosystem. Under his guidance, SHIB launched Shibarium, an Ethereum Layer2, and expanded into DeFi, NFTs, and even a metaverse. Meanwhile, Litecoin (LTC) is the veteran peer-to-peer digital currency, a PoW network that has been running since 2011, often called 'digital silver' to Bitcoin's gold. The rumor suggests some kind of link between Kusama and Litecoin, though no details, no technical proof, and no official statement exist. The source is a single 'SHIB veteran' whose identity remains as opaque as the rumor itself. Now, the core insight. In my years managing digital asset funds, I've learned that rumors in crypto are rarely random; they are signals of underlying structural tensions. This one, in particular, speaks to a desperate search for narrative in a bull market where every project needs a story to justify its valuation. From my experience auditing 40+ ICO whitepapers in 2017, I've seen how quickly communities latch onto external validation. SHIB, despite its massive community, suffers from a fundamental weakness: it is a Layer2 token on Ethereum, but its value is almost entirely driven by meme and sentiment, not by utility. The Shibarium L2, while technically functional, has faced the same fragmentation problem I've warned about for years. There are dozens of Layer2s now, but the same small user base โ€” this isn't scaling, it's slicing already-scarce liquidity into fragments. Litecoin, on the other hand, is a solid, independent L1 with a proven track record, but its community is conservative and values technical substance over hype. By linking Kusama to Litecoin, the rumor attempts to bridge two worlds: the speculative energy of meme coins with the perceived legitimacy of an old-guard network. But the structural reality is stark. There is no native cross-chain interoperability between SHIB and Litecoin. Cross-chain bridges, which I've analyzed extensively, have been hacked for over $2.5 billion cumulatively, yet the industry still depends on them โ€” a fundamental security paradox. Even if the rumor were true, the technical path to integration would be fraught with risk. The SHIB community would need to trust a bridge, or migrate to a new chain, both of which are costly and improbable. The rumor is not about technology; it's about attention. Here is where the contrarian angle emerges. The decoupling thesis in crypto often focuses on Bitcoin vs. altcoins, but I see a different decoupling: the separation between narrative and fundamentals. In a bull market, euphoria masks technical flaws. The Shytoshi Kusama-Litecoin rumor is a perfect example. While the market is busy speculating on a potential partnership, it ignores the real risks: the regulatory precedent set by the Tornado Cash sanctions, which put all open-source developers at legal risk, and the inherent fragility of meme coin ecosystems that depend on a single pseudonymous leader. The silence between the candlesticks tells me that the real story is not the rumor itself, but the community's hunger for a narrative that can sustain the hype. Flow follows the path of least resistance, and right now, the path of least resistance is to chase rumors rather than to examine the structural integrity of the underlying assets. Take a step back. The SHIB veteran's take is likely a calculated move to gauge market reaction, or simply a reflection of internal community chatter. But for a macro watcher like me, the signal is not the rumor; it's the noise. The silence reveals that the market is ignoring the fundamental question: can SHIB generate sustainable value beyond its meme appeal? The answer, based on my analysis of tokenomics and network effects, is no โ€” not without a radical shift in utility. Litecoin, with its fixed supply and robust mining network, does not need SHIB; SHIB desperately needs Litecoin's credibility. This asymmetry is the real story. Diving for pearls in the deep web of value, I see a pattern: during every bull market, the same cycle repeats. A meme coin leader is linked to a 'legacy' project, the community gets excited, the price spikes briefly, and then the rumor fades, leaving holders with the same fundamental problems. The silence between the candlesticks is the sound of reality waiting to be heard. Patience is the leverage that never depreciates. The takeaway for the disciplined investor: ignore the noise, watch the on-chain data, and ask yourself whether the narrative is built on code or on hope. The answer will determine who survives the next correction.
